Separation and preconcentration of platinum group metals and gold on modified silica and XAD sorbents in the presence of cationic surfactants for their determination by ICP-AES
Original language description
Various modified silica sorbents and bare silica were tested for the separation and preconcentration of 10 - 200 ng cm-3 from 50 - 1000 cm3 sample volume of platinum group metals (PGMs), Pt(IV, II), Pd(II), Ir(IV), Rh(III), Os(VI), Ru(IV) and Au(III) inthe form of ion associates of their chloro and bromo complexes with cationic surfactants. (1-(ethoxycarbonyl)pentadecyl) trimethylammonium bromide (Septonex?), benzyl(dodecyl)dimethylammonium bromide (Sterinol?), trimethyl(tetradecyl)- ammonium bromide and hexadecyl(trimethyl)ammonium chloride are suitable from 0.1 mol dm-3 HCl or 0.1 mol dm-3 HBr. A 100% recovery for Pd(II), Pt(IV) and Au(III) was obtained with octadecyl silicas Separon? SGX C18, Separon? SGX RPS and Phenyl? silica in the presence of 0.006 mol dm-3 Septonex? or 0.003 mol dm-3 Sterinol?.
